Murphy's Irish Pub: Paramaribo's Original Irish Corner
Draft beer, leprechaun wings, and a four-sided fireplace in the middle of Suriname.
Why Go
Somewhere between the Amazon and the equator, a proper Irish pub is pouring cold pints, roaring trivia questions across the room, and somehow keeping a fireplace lit year-round. Murphy's has been Paramaribo's off-duty living room since 2003 ΓÇö the first (and still the most convincing) Irish pub in Suriname, tucked into the International Mall on Ringweg-Zuid.
The Experience
Walk in after sundown and Murphy's does a very specific trick: it feels like Dublin decided to move to the tropics without changing its wardrobe. Dark wood, taps lined up, football on a wall of flat screens, and ΓÇö the flex of the room ΓÇö a four-sided fireplace anchoring the indoor bar. The crowd is a mash-up you don't get anywhere else in Paramaribo: Surinamese regulars, expats debriefing the workweek, and travelers who wandered in for one drink and stayed for trivia night. Grab a stool at the bar for the pub feel, or slip out to the terrace when the humidity breaks and you want to hear yourself talk. Service is unhurried in the best sense ΓÇö this is a place to settle in, not to eat and run.
What to Try
Start with the leprechaun hot wings ΓÇö they're the house signature and hotter than they look, so order the garlic fries as a cooling wingman. The kitchen leans hearty pub classics with a Surinamese-Brazilian churrasco streak, so if you're hungry, a grilled plate holds up better than the burger. On the drinks side, they actually know their way around a gin and tonic (rare in a beer town), but the correct order is a cold draft from the taps ΓÇö it's the whole reason people come here instead of the mall's other options. Ask what's on the daily specials board before you commit.
Insider Tip
Time your visit around trivia night ΓÇö dates rotate, so ask the bartender when the next one lands and reserve a small table if you're in a group of four or more, because regulars fill the room fast. Also: Murphy's doesn't open until 5 PM, so it's an evening play only. If you're pub-crawling with a Surinamese local, this is the stop where you switch from Parbo lagers to something on draft you can't get anywhere else in town.
The Practical Stuff
Address: Ringweg-Zuid 245, Unit C, inside the International Mall of Suriname, Paramaribo. Hours: SunΓÇôWed 5 PMΓÇômidnight, Thu 5 PMΓÇô1 AM, FriΓÇôSat 5 PMΓÇô2 AM. Kitchen closes before the bar, so eat earlier in the window. No cover charge, even on live music nights. Cards generally accepted but bring some SRD cash as backup. Parking at the mall is easy. Family-owned since 2003. Phone: +597 858-9988.
